Jim Dewan is a seasoned executive, educator, and writer with expertise in culinary arts, event planning, and publishing. He has taught at several institutions, including the Old Town School of Folk Music and Kendall College, and has written for various publications, including the Chicago Tribune and Plate Magazine. Dewan has also worked as a freelance musician, composer, and songwriter, and has performed with notable artists such as Robbie Fulks.
